The Smart Shopper’s Guide to Affordable Vacuums

Finding a good vacuum doesn’t have to cost a lot of money. Many affordable vacuums work great for everyday cleaning. This guide will help you pick the best one for your needs.

Key Features to Look For

When you shop for a cheap vacuum, think about these important things:

  • Suction Power: This is how well the vacuum picks up dirt. Look for vacuums that mention strong suction.
  • Bagged vs. Bagless:
    • Bagged vacuums use bags to collect dirt. You throw the bag away when it’s full. This is good for people with allergies because the dirt is sealed inside.
    • Bagless vacuums have a bin you empty. This saves money because you don’t buy bags. It’s also easier to see when the bin needs emptying.
  • Attachments: Many vacuums come with tools to clean different things.
    • Crevice tool: Great for tight spots and corners.
    • Upholstery tool: Perfect for cleaning furniture and car seats.
    • Brush roll: Helps lift dirt from carpets.
  • Weight and Maneuverability: A lighter vacuum is easier to push and carry. If you have stairs, a lighter model is a big plus.
  • Cord Length: A longer cord means you can clean more without unplugging.

Important Materials

The materials used in a vacuum affect how long it lasts and how well it works.

  • Plastic: Most vacuums use plastic. Stronger plastic means the vacuum is less likely to break.
  • Metal: Some parts, like the wand or brush roll, might be metal. Metal parts are usually stronger and last longer.
  • Filters: Good filters trap dust and allergens. HEPA filters are the best for trapping tiny particles.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) About Cheap Vacuums

Q1: Can a cheap vacuum really clean well?

A1: Yes, many affordable vacuums are designed to clean everyday dirt and messes effectively. You might not get all the fancy features, but they can still do a great job.

Q2: What is the most important feature in a cheap vacuum?

A2: Suction power is the most important feature. It determines how well the vacuum picks up dirt and debris.

Q3: Is it better to get a bagged or bagless vacuum if I’m on a budget?

A3: Bagless vacuums are often cheaper in the long run because you don’t have to buy replacement bags. However, if you have allergies, a bagged vacuum might be worth the extra cost for better containment.
